Paul (Walnuts)

Blueberry cream cheese croffle, toowomba panini and caramel machiatto are really great and prices are fair. $5-6 drinks, $8 or so for the croffle, $17 for sandwich very good quality. Wasnt busy at 12:30 when I went so was quick.Feel like its one of those places where everything is pretty good and some are standouts depending on what you like.

Diana Nguyen

The BEST breakfast/brunch food in Boston! I loved how balanced the dishes were and well portioned (not too little or too much). Prices are very fair. My favorite has to be the smoked salmon sandwich and blueberry croffle. Super delicious!! The pancakes and western omelette were also great.I didn’t enjoy the caramel croffle because it was too sweet. Could’ve been better if it was topped with Biscoff instead of caramel. The Boston cheese steak omelette was a miss because the beef was mixed with tomato sauce/had a sweet taste, which was odd with the omelette. The home fries were slightly on the burnt side. Regardless, everything else I tried was amazing.Beware: if you go during peak lunch hours, they are very understaffed and it will take a while to place your order.In terms of drinks, the einspanner coffee was to die for. This is going to be my new go-to place for breakfast!!
